In Norse traditions, it was common for couples to send each of their guests home with products. This is a tradition that carries on today. It is common to see a gift register at Swedish marriages, but it’s not the norm to acquire big financial efforts, as most people can afford to buy themselves a present.

After the service, it’s time to enjoy! Swedish weddings are known for their longer, elaborate dining parties. The night may contain from eight to 12 speeches, screenings of clips from the bachelor and bachelorette parties, games and songs. A friend of the couple is usually designated master of ceremonies to coordinate all the entertainment.

Another quirky Scandinavian wedding tradition is that whenever the groom or bride leaves a room for any reason, other men will line up to kiss them. This is one of our favorite things to capture on camera as a photographer because it’s so funny!
